What to Do After an Accident in Michigan

  1. Do not sign anything from the insurer — Early settlement offers are designed to close your claim fast — before your full damages are known. Say nothing until you have legal guidance.
  2. Document everything — Photos, medical records, witness contacts, and a written account of what happened all strengthen your claim.
  3. Track all your losses — Medical bills, missed work, and ongoing pain all factor into what you may be owed. Keep records from day one.
